Welcome to owning a low production number car with many discontinued parts. It sucks but you can find parts if you are patient.

So the technique is find the part number for your car, right click and search that part number, then determine if that part number is shared among any other models. If it isn't then you have to use the unique part, modify another part that is close, buy aftermarket, or make something custom.
